What owners report

  • Tl* the contact owns a 2008 suzuki boulevard m109r. The contact stated that the vehicle failed to start. The contact replaced the battery, but the failure persisted. The vin was not included in nhtsa campaign number: 11v108000 (electrical system). The vehicle was not diagnosed or repaired. The manufacturer was made…

    Electrical System · filed Sep 14, 2015

  • This bike has a problem shifting into 2nd gear. When starting from a complete stop, the bike constantly refuses to go into 2nd gear. This is dangerous when there is traffic behind you and they expect you to continue to move forward. Having to fish for 2nd puts us riders in jeopardy. Dealers only state that is is a…

    Power Train · filed Apr 9, 2014

  • Tl* the contact owns a 2008 suzuki boulevard m109r motorcycle. The contact stated that while driving 45 mph, the vehicle shifted out of gear and into neutral without warning. The vehicle was taken to the dealer where the technician diagnosed that the transmission needed to be rebuilt. The manufacturer was not made…

    Power Train · filed Mar 18, 2014
